Legend:

Iterations
number of analysed simulation runs (involving this choice)
Mean Depth
average number of turns simulation runs lasted
MyScore[n]
average number of points you score on your nth turn
OppScore[n]
average number of points opponent scores on his/her nth turn
95% +-
95% confidence margin for preceding figure
Reached%
percentage of runs which reach this depth
0lp%, etc.
percentage of runs where 0, 1, 2, ..., 7 tiles get played
ResidualEq
equity unaccounted for by raw scores (final rack leave, etc.)
NetEquity
equity as reported by Maven
